Package: apt Version: 0.6.43.3 Severity: important Tags: l10n In the german locale (de_DE), apt asks:
Möchten Sie fortfahren [J/n]? (Do you want to continue [Y/n]?) and eventually Diese Pakete ohne Überprüfung installieren [j/N]? (Install these packages without verification [y/N]?) If you answer 'j' apt acts as if you'd answer 'n'! Only if you answer 'y' apt continues as expected. This normally does not occur in the first case, as 'y' is the predefined answer and you virtually allways only hit enter. But in the second case the predefined answer is 'n', so you have to tell apt that you really want to install these packages by answering 'j', what causes apt to cancel because it expects 'y'!
